Ipswich is Suffolk’s County Town and due to recent and significant regeneration projects, the town is alive and bustling. It has a thriving business district, an excellent cultural and arts scene, a constantly growing food and drink offering, sports and outdoor activities galore, some spectacular coastal, rural and architectural scenery, many places of interest to visit, and not forgetting the impressive history and heritage of the area which dates back to the Anglo-Saxon times. You will not be bored visiting Suffolk!
Ipswich has a great transport service network of buses, trains and taxis as well as good access to A12 / A14 arterial roads and is just one hour from both London Stansted and London Southend airports by car, and the train from London Liverpool Street.
Christchurch Park is the oldest public park in Ipswich and opened in 1895 and was officially 're-opened' in May 2008, after the completion of a £4.5 million restoration project funded by the Heritage Lottery Fund and Ipswich Borough Council. It extends over 33 hectares of picturesque grounds right in the heart of the town, and houses Christchurch Mansion; a beautiful Tudor mansion with over 500 years of history and is free to enter.
